How are dholes threatened?

Dholes are threatened by habitat loss due to deforestation, agricultural expansion, and human development. They are also hunted and killed by humans, both for sport and to protect livestock. Climate change and changes in prey availability are also potential threats to dhole populations.

Dholes are threatened by habitat loss, fragmentation, and degradation due to human activities, such as deforestation, agricultural expansion, and mining. They are also vulnerable to hunting, both directly and through the impact of snaring on their prey. Disease transmission from domestic dogs is also a significant threat to dhole populations. Conservation efforts, such as protected area management and community engagement, are crucial for their survival.
